Robert S. Clyde, 95, originally of Elkhart, IN, went to be with his Heavenly Father on Tuesday, November 30, 2021 in Sheboygan Falls, WI, at Pine Haven Christian Communities where he had been living since February 2020. He married his wife, Audrey, of Ontario, Canada, on June 19, 1954 at Gospel Center United Missionary Church, South Bend, Indiana.
Robert ("Bob") graduated from Elkhart High School in 1944, after which he served in the U.S. Army Air Corps during the remainder of WWII. He graduated from Bethel College, Mishawaka, IN (1950), and then Asbury Theological Seminary, Wilmore, KY (1952). Bob was the first U.S. Navy chaplain from the United Missionary Church, serving aboard the USS Norton Sound, the Navy's first guided missile ship, during the close of the Korean War era. He and Audrey then moved to Ontario, Canada, where Bob served as a professor and dean at Emmanuel Bible College, Kitchener, Ontario and later as a church pastor in the United Church of Canada for many years. Bob and Audrey returned to northern Indiana in 1982, where they were most recently members of Nappanee Missionary Church, Nappanee, IN. Bob was an avid reader and story-teller, who loved his family deeply.
